Filled
This offer is not available anymore

Senior Java Software Engineer in Barcelona

Netquest

Workplace
Onsite
Hours
Full-Time
Internship
No
Skills
Share offer

Job Description

Netquest is among the most advanced and innovative digital data collection specialists worldwide in the market research and analytics industry. We currently have more than 2,000,000 consumers willing to share their behavioral data and give us their opinion in 27 countries.

Our ambition is to be the most reliable, flexible and powerful data source in the market, and contribute to the future of market research through automation and innovation.

Job description

Next time you go shopping, think about this: What if brands asked for your opinion on their products before they put them on the shelf? Wouldn’t that be nice? At Netquest we give voice to the consumers enabling them to shape the products and services of tomorrow. How? We deliver consumers’ genuine opinions and data to help companies create better products for you.

 

We’re now looking for a Senior Java Software Engineer to join our development team and help us outline our platforms’ architecture, participating in the definition of technology stack and the design of the involved services.

Several years ago we built our own platform and due to the evolution of the business and the technology, we´re rebuilding it from scratch adapting it to our current and future needs, and the volume of data we're currently dealing with, and also prepare it to handle the business growth we're experiencing.

We are now focused on developing solutions to support our business need to engage & communicate with our clients. Some of them are: a DIY project commissioning tool, an intelligent users routing, integrations with providers APIs...

 

We offer you:

 

● To be part of a team always interested in the newest technology, depending on your

skills and assignment, the stack you´ll work with may include: JAVA, Spring Boot,

Python, MySQL, NoSQL, AWS, Docker, Kubernetes, etc.

● A challenging project, where you can learn new things every day and show the team what you’ve got

● A nice place to work, where we foster training, as well as professional and personal development

● Flexible working hours with remote work options

● Flexible retribution: meal and transport tickets, kindergarden cheques and/or private health insurance.

 

At Netquest, we’re a team in constant growth. Currently, we’re more than 250 people coming from 27 nationalities. We’re committed to equal employment opportunity and we strive to be a more equal opportunity workplace day by day.

Requirements

Your profile:

 

● You are experienced in development with JAVA (8/11)

● You have software development patterns knowledge and deep technical and

software design background

● You have experience working with Git and some variant of Gitflow

● You are interested and/or experienced in high performance distributed systems

● You have some testing automation knowledge and experience on web standards

● You are committed to development and quality, with a perfection-driven attitude

● You are curious and proactive about development methodologies and techniques

 

It’s a plus if:

● You have work experience on RDBMS and NoSQL systems

● You are interested and/or experienced in functional programming paradigm

● You are familiar with the usage of persistence systems such as Cassandra, Couchbase, MongoDB or Redis.

 

About Netquest

Netquest is among the most advanced and innovative digital data collection specialists worldwide in the market research and analytics industry. We currently have more than 2,000,000 consumers willing to share their behavioral data and give us their opinion in 27 countries.

Our ambition is to be the most reliable, flexible and powerful data source in the market, and contribute to the future of market research through automation and innovation.

Other backend developer jobs that might interest you...